Demonstration in Rabat
Louis Witter / Le Pictorium
LePictorium_0215484.jpg
Nearly two hundred human rights activists demonstrate in front of the parliament in Rabat, Morocco on Wednesday, October 2, 2019, to demand the release of journalist Hajar Raissouni, arrested at the end of August for - abortion - and - sexual relations out of wedlock.
